We’re looking for a Support Technician I in Valhalla, NY to help us.
Description
As a Support Technician I, you will provide day-to-day technical support for end user hardware and software needs and project-based support onsite. You will be responsible for providing routine, technical support and maintenance for desktop, laptop, telecom and network systems including hardware, application software, operating systems and connectivity. Your responsibilities will include fixing hardware and software issues and document resolution and support as needed in addition to installing, configuring, and updating end-user desktop and laptop software with support as needed. You will also be responsible for prioritizing and advancing issues when appropriate, using knowledge transfer forums to identify and resolve problems as well as chip in to all phases of desktop or telecom support, including coordination, monitoring, tracking, and resolution, related to client installations, upgrades, software, hardware, operating systems, and operating system configuration issues. Finally, you will also perform telecom moves, adds and changes (MAC work) for end users with limited support.
